Rainbow VHF/UHF Repeater Site

Click Picture for larger PDF

The Rainbow VHF/UHF Repeater Site is located in Rio Rancho, NM at approximately 35°16’22.8″N 106°43’55.2″W in a multi-agency facility. The Repeater system is linked to the Pajarito repeater using a VHF link-radio system, but an upgraded 5 Ghz link system is currently under construction, to allow the current link radio to be utilized for connection to the La Madera repeater, which is currently stand-alone. The repeater has a 25 watt RF output on both the 147.10 Mhz and 443.10 Mhz systems (both use the standard offset, CTCSS Tone 100hz). The antennas for both systems consist of 4-bay exposed dipole antennas, located at approximately 180 feet above ground level on the tower, giving these repeaters a wide coverage over almost all of Sandoval County, and into the adjoining counties as well.
